The Endless Mountain Music Festival opens its 2025 season with a truly unforgettable musical event — uniting the worlds of pop and classical music through the talents of three legendary singer-songwriters. On July 18 and 19, audiences in the Twin Tiers region will be treated to a once-in-a-lifetime weekend of premieres, star appearances, and extraordinary performances.


Not only will music by Melissa Manchester, Jimmy Webb, and Neil Sedaka be featured in powerful new arrangements for piano and orchestra — Melissa Manchester and Jimmy Webb will be performing live as special guests, making this weekend even more iconic!

Both concerts will feature acclaimed pianist Jeffrey Biegel, who will take on three works written by these iconic artists, performed alongside the Endless Mountain Music Festival Orchestra under the direction of Stephen Gunzenhauser.


Friday, July 18 opens the festival at Steadman Theatre at Commonwealth University in Mansfield. The evening begins with Navarro’s Libertadores, followed by the Pennsylvania premiere of Jimmy Webb’s Nocturne—with Webb himself in attendance and Jeffrey Biegel at the piano. The concert closes with Dvořák’s The Golden Spinning Wheel, a dramatic tone poem that perfectly ties together a night themed around storytelling and transformation.


The energy continues Saturday, July 19, at the beautiful Corning Museum of Glass. The centerpiece of the evening is the world premiere of AWAKE!, a brand new piano concerto composed by Melissa Manchester—who will also be there in person to introduce and celebrate the piece. Also on the program is Neil Sedaka’s Manhattan Intermezzo, performed by Biegel, followed by Brahms’ Symphony No. 4, a majestic close to an evening of innovation and homage.
